The 2023 One-Day Cup (also known as for sponsorship reasons as 2023 Metro Bank One Day Cup) was a limited overs cricket competition that formed part of the 2023 domestic cricket season in England and Wales. Matches were contested over 50 overs per side, having List A cricket status, with all eighteen first-class counties competing in the tournament. The tournament started on 1 August 2023, with the final taking place on 16 September 2023 at Trent Bridge in Nottingham. Kent were the defending champions, having won the 2022 tournament.
Leicestershire beat Hampshire by two runs in the final, winning their first List A trophy since 1985.
